In a blank, fresh sheet I want:
to check the range on the "Master tab'! cells O21:O92, and if it finds the
word relief, give me the result of the 40th column (BB) from whatever row it
found the word relief. The cell it was found may be 'Master tab'!O36. So the
result of 'master tab'! BB36 I would want in row 2 of my fresh sheet.
The next find of relief might be in 'Master Tab'!O58. Give me the result of
the 'Master tab'! BB58, and put that result in row 3 in my fresh sheet, etc.

Presumably, B4 in the other sheet contains "relief."

Here's one approach with Excel 2003.

In the other sheet put this in C2:
=IF(ISNUMBER(FIND($B$4,MasterTab!O21)),MAX(C$1:C1) +1,"")
and this in D2:
=IF(ROW()-1MAX(C:C),"",
OFFSET(MasterTab!$O$21,MATCH(ROW()-1,C:C,0)-2,39))
then select C2:D2 and copy down for the length of the list.

Column D should contain the desired list. Column B is a helper column,
and can be hidden.
